A major road in south Manchester was sealed off by police this evening after reports of a crash. Officers were called to the A6 Stockport Road in Longsight.
The road was taped off in both directions at Dickenson Road for around two hours on Saturday evening (April 9) due to what Transport for Greater Manchester described as a 'police incident.' Pictures from the scene show a badly damaged black BMW being towed away from the scene.
